Positron Emission Tomography/Computed Tomography Scan Details: What to Anticipate During the Examination
A PET/CT scan involves lying on a table that moves into a substantial machine, resembling a bore. You’ll get a tiny amount of tracer material, often given through a line in your arm. This substance helps the physicians view processes in your tissues. The scan typically lasts between half and a couple of time span, including preparation and the scan length. Throughout the scan, you’ll be requested to remain very still to obtain distinct pictures. You may detect whirring tones from the equipment.
Full-Body PET/CT: Detailed Cancer Staging Defined
Complete-body PET Scan/CT Scan is a advanced scanning procedure used to accurately evaluate tumor in the complete body. This image combines the metabolic data from a Positron Emission Tomography - which detects areas of increased metabolic activity - with the precise physical images from a Computed Tomography. This combined approach enables oncologists to find main tumors and potential secondary growths that might be overlooked by traditional imaging modalities. Ultimately, it offers a essential view of the tumor's scope and influence on the patient's well-being.
